M6 Smart Motorway Extension
(AKA automated money collecting machine)
First of all the residents are not against the M6 Smart Motorway Extension what they would like to achieve is that the pollution that is coming from the motorway in noise and air quality exceeding European Union Safety levels and world health organisations recommendations are addressed at the time of the new construction.
